Top Simulation Games You Can't Miss
If you're searching for engaging gameplay while on the go, check out these standout simulation games:
- Stardew Valley: A farming simulation classic. Grow crops, raise animals, and develop relationships in a charming rural setting.
- Animal Crossing: Pocket Camp: Create your own campsite and engage with adorable animal characters while decorating and custom-designing your environment.
- Cities: Skylines: This city-building game allows you to create the metropolis of your dreams, complete with infrastructure and public services.
- The Sims Mobile: Build homes, craft lives, and control the drama of Sims in this mobile adaptation of the iconic franchise.
- RollerCoaster Tycoon Touch: For thrill-seekers, this game lets you design amusement parks and build the wildest roller coasters imaginable.
A Table for Quick Reference
Here’s a quick comparison of some of the best simulation games:
| Game Title | Genre | Developer | Price |
|---|---|---|---|
| Stardew Valley | Farming RPG | ConcernedApe | $4.99 |
| Animal Crossing: Pocket Camp | Life Simulation | Nintendo | Free |
| Cities: Skylines | City Builder | Colossal Order | $14.99 |
| The Sims Mobile | Life Simulation | Maxis | Free |
| RollerCoaster Tycoon Touch | Tycoon Simulation | Atari | Free |
